Output 6605996c7e5e207b00e46c74c94556cc4775a9a48ea6f22a61a82225b1604e36:1

value
70293389
script pubkey
OP_0 OP_PUSHBYTES_20 164dd75a94295d969579a1af17aac6849725fd0f
address
bc1qzexawk5599wed9te5xh302kxsjtjtlg0dk0j7t
transaction
6605996c7e5e207b00e46c74c94556cc4775a9a48ea6f22a61a82225b1604e36